Output 7712961837cd220abb5ed9241a1b5929f85db34510084989e02d7516dd3fb976:0

value
148549864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96b36297e50566b6c3c6b319ac1710382a34ccc4 OP_EQUAL
address
MMdzV6sjm7U3BND17iR9eoPNAab9UxuDV2
transaction
7712961837cd220abb5ed9241a1b5929f85db34510084989e02d7516dd3fb976
spent
true